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Amazing location with scenic view of one of the beautiful Durmitor peaks - "Savin Kuk". The house is perfectly oriented and located at the top of the hill. The road to the house is pretty well - there's no problem reaching it with the usual car. The house is well equipped, very cozy, and comfortable. It has a solid fuel heating system, so you can see the flame in the evening, and it makes it super atmospheric. Overall, there's enough space inside, you have two isolated bedrooms on the second floor. Location is very close to the hiking trails - you don't need a car to get anywhere.

MontenegroNot something that host can directly control, but keep in mind that your peace and quiet depends on who stays next door because we had a couple with two small children as neighbours, so it wasnt peace and quiet anymore, since there was no railing preventing kids to spend some time on our terrace too, cabins are veeery close to each other.
Spectacular view! Beautiful surroundings! If you like to explore, location is excellent, you can walk to Black Lake and Zminje Lake easily. Ask host how to get there before coming to easily find the place. Kitchen well equipped. Center of Zabljak only 5-10 min away by car, so you are close but not in the middle of crowded town which was exactly what we wanted.

FinlandThere are two separate cottages very close to each other on the plot, and both have their own terraces with a wonderful view. The place is isolated in a good way and the environment is really quiet. We spent 4 nights there and the cabin next to us had different people every night. Fortunately, there were no problems because people who value silence and the peace of nature will probably come here. The views from the terrace of the cottage are great. The cottage is also well equipped. We used the washing machine and the laundry dried quickly outside. Every morning we ate breakfast on the terrace and in the evenings we went to restaurants. You should definitely stay here for at least 3 nights and visit the Black Lakes, Tara Canyon, Pluzine/Piva Lake.

ItalyAs the hut is in the mountains, do not expect much around. I highly recommend getting a car before going to Zabljak - we were told there's no rental car available in the city. We ended up doing things by foot, what can be exhausting since the closest store or bus station is +5km away going up/down the mountains. Taxi from Zabljak costed us €15. If renting a car is not an option, get some groceries before going up. They do offer a Dolce Gusto coffee machine, but you need to bring your capsules. Otherwise, you can use the supplies offered to prepare Turkish coffee.
The view is simply amazing! The hut was super clean and everything looked brand new. They offer the basic amenities and kitchen supplies. We got there much earlier than check-in time and were able to leave our luggage there and explore the surrounding. They have 2 lovely dogs that followed us during the hiking 😍
